    Default New to the Curve

    I haven't owned a Curve since the 8120, and will soon be using a Sprint 9330. I know stock it shipped with OS5, and can be upgraded to OS6. Is OS7 available or should I just wait until I get my 9930 for that?

    The 9330 will never get OS7, OS 6 works great on it though. If you want OS 7 then you need the 9930 or any of the new BlackBerry phones out there.
